c语言选择语句

1、开始赋值为0是初始化,避免未输入时不合法的使用s
2、不行,s%10是s对10取模,结果是一个小于10的数,例如25%10=5,不合要求。

㈡ C语言与C++,怎么抉择

建议三条路里面的东西有主次有先后有选择地学

  1. 最重要的是数据结构,数据结构是必须要先学得,同时可以大概了解一下C++,学习一下面向对象的东西。

  2. 然后次重要的是深入学习C,同时可以粗略学学操作系统

  3. 然后学习数据库的时候可以学学java,数据库比java本身重要,主要学数据库,java用来作为编写数据库程序的工具。

㈢ c语言选择

题目38 B
至少要包含一个main函数

题目39 A
a%=(n%=2),先计算括号里面的,优先级最高,n%=2即n=n%2,所以n=1
整个表达式就变成了a%=1即a=a%1,所以a=0

题目40 B
C语言使用0表示逻辑假,非0(默认使用1)表示逻辑真
而b>c即2>1为逻辑真,所以a=1

题目41 A
标示符只能包含数字、字母和下划线_,并且需要以字母或下划线_开头

题目42 C
char是一个字符类型,''这个没有字符是错误的,如果想表达空格,需要使用' '。

题目43 C
(int)x+y,先将x变成int类型,1.2丢弃小数部分变成1.0,然后再和y相加,1.0+2.0=3.0

题目44 A
全局变量,顾名思义,全局都可以使用,即整个程序有效。

㈣ c语言的选择法

C语言选择大概有三种方法,分别是。
if-else
switch
statement?statement1:statement2

㈤ C语言2个选择急求

第一题选D 第二题C
输入的时候格式为%d%c
所以输入10 Y
第二题 a=1 执行b++但因为没有跳转
所以执行case 2: b++;再跳出去
所以b=2

㈥ C语言 选择结构 选择语句

if(){}
else if(){}
else
第一 没有if是不能写 else if 和else的.
第二 用if或者else if,应该看你第二个判断条件是否要在第一个判断条件的基础上进行。
例如: int a = 1;
int b = 1;
if(a==1){printf("hello world\n");}
else if (b==1){printf("hello");}
else {printf("no");}
在本段函数中 因为符合第一条语句,所以输出helloworld elseif 和else不执行;
假如else if改为 if 则在打印hello world 的基础上还要打印 hello。

其实在本质上 else if(b==1)的意思是if(b==1&&a!=1)

㈦ c语言中的选择语句(请高手教导)

if只能判断一个条件成立或者不成立两种情况。
多情况的时候需要嵌套或者用else if{} else if{}....

而switch直接就是多分支的结构。可以根据多种情况直接选择分支。

所以对于真假的逻辑判断,用if好
对于变量值的多种情况判断,用switch好些吧

㈧ c语言选择=

a==1,b==2,c==2
判断:
a<b<c即(a<b)<c
a<b成立值为1,
1<c成立,值为1(逻辑真)
循环:
a==2,b==1,c==1
判断:
a<b不成立,值为0,
0<c成立,值为1(逻辑真)
循环:
a==1,b==2,c==0
a<b成立,值为1
1<c不成立,值为0(逻辑假)
不再循环
输出。

㈨ c语言选择法

原谅我帮不了你,我大一的时候学了c但是我现在已经忘光光了

㈩ c语言选择

描述错误的是
A、scanf("%lf%lf",&a,&b);可以给两个变量正确赋值
因为给a输入应该是scanf("%f",&a);